Memoirs are a beautiful and engaging genre of fiction, presenting facts with honesty and sincerity. Arabic literature has known many biographers who have preserved the history of the most famous figures in politics, thought, science and literature. Among the many memoirs that Dar Al Mada has been keen to publish are those of the writer and author Balqis Sharara, which she titled "Thus the Days Passed." In them, she recounts her early life in the holy city of Najaf, where she was born into a family interested in literature and culture. Her father, Mohammed Sharara, was one of the most prominent cultural and intellectual figures in Iraq in the thirties and forties of the last century. These memoirs are not the first experience of the writer Balqis Sharara in biographical literature. She previously published, in collaboration with her husband, the great architect Rifaat Chadirji, the book "A Wall Between Two Darknesses" and her important book "The Kitchen and Its Role in Human Civilization." She also published an introduction to the novel "If the Days Darken" about Sharara's life.
In the pages of these memoirs, we read about the most important events that Iraq has witnessed over the past eight decades, and we also read a description of the cultural situation that Iraq has experienced over the past decades.
